β¦ Synopsis
Platelet aggregation plays an important role in blood clotting. Robust numerical methods for simulating the behavior of Fogelson's continuum models of platelet aggregation have been developed which in particular involve a hybrid finite-difference and spectral method for the models' link evolution equation. This partial differential equation involves four spatial dimensions and time. The new methods are used to begin investigating the influence of new chemically induced activation, link formation, and shear-induced link breaking in determining when aggregates develop sufficient strength to remain intact and when they are broken apart by fluid stresses.
